Output 50327edcd8d2571db52da7474a3a19ea5b4e0a01737fc2ef993f3059d01a908a:1

value
14803086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841d1e6a0161ea30612be665c064d6f6fa8f9a72 OP_EQUAL
address
3Dja15KwDU8B2CbqfpvxZFkzk9JeAPQCHo
transaction
50327edcd8d2571db52da7474a3a19ea5b4e0a01737fc2ef993f3059d01a908a
spent
true